Abstract
A method and apparatus for adjusting a variable parameter of a dynamic system in response to a signal representative of the system performance so as to optimize system performance with respect to that parameter. A first signal related to system performance is extracted from the dynamic system and is thereafter coupled to a plurality of performance index blocks, each of these blocks for operating on this signal according to a different predetermined characteristic transfer function. The output level from a selected performance index block is periodically sampled and the sampled level is compared with a previously sampled level to provide a positive or negative difference signal. A first pulsed signal is formed wherein pulses and zero levels are respectively representative of the incidence of opposite polarity levels in the difference signal. This first pulsed signal is converted into a second pulsed signal wherein the leading and trailing edges of the pulses correspond to the incidence of adjacent pulses in the first pulsed signal. The zero axis position is shifted in relation to the second pulsed signal to obtain positive and negative signals whose width is representative of the extent to which the variable parameter of the dynamic system must be inreased or decreased. The positive and negative signals are integrated to provide an output signal for adjusting this variable parameter.
